Unit Description:

  • PACU is a 15-bay phase I recovery area for patients undergoing anesthesia for various surgical and interventional procedures. 
  • Some of the surgical procedures performed in the OR’s include hernia repair, cholecystectomies, appendectomies, large and small bowel resections, trauma, ortho trauma, orthopedic joint replacement, neurosurgical, ortho neurosurgery, cardiac and vascular surgery, urology, and other specialty surgeries.  
  • PACU staff assist with bedside procedures requiring anesthesia support such as perioperative nerve blocks, transesophageal echocardiograms, cardioversions, and blood patches. 
  • The PACU staff work collaboratively with the anesthesia providers and all members of the surgical team.
  • We champion a team-based approach to individualized patient care and work alongside surgeons, surgical residents, and general medicine providers. 
  • Our care team includes: The PCM and Resource Nurse who can assist with access to education, resources, guidelines, and protocols.
  • PACU is a high-acuity area providing exposure to a variety of surgical treatment and critical care nursing skills.
  • Post Anesthesia Care Nursing is a specialty clinical area with its own nationally recognized certification; CPAN- Certified Post Anesthesia Nurse.  Test fee reimbursement offered with successful completion of certification exam.
